Denver in May

Great time to visit

May is peak Denver - everyone's outdoors, patios are packed, and the Front Range looks impossibly green against snow-capped peaks. Book everything early because the whole city comes alive.

Weather

May delivers some of Denver's most perfect weather with warm days, cool nights, and afternoon thunderstorms that clear quickly. The air is still dry and comfortable, though UV exposure at altitude requires constant vigilance. Late spring snow is possible but rare.

24°C high7°C low11 rain days

May Tips

  • Sunscreen is non-negotiable - you'll burn in 15 minutes
  • Book patio reservations early at spots like Root Down
  • Bike rentals get expensive - use B-Cycle share system

April through October gives you the best weather, but each season brings something different. Spring arrives late — expect snow through April, sometimes May. But once it clears, the hiking trails open and the city shakes off winter. Summer means festival season. The Underground Music Showcase takes over South Broadway in July, while the Great American Beer Festival packs downtown in October. Hotel prices spike during these events, so book early or stay further out. Fall brings perfect hiking weather and golden aspens in the mountains. September and October see the most stable weather patterns — warm days, cool nights, minimal rain. Winter divides into two camps: powder days and inversion days. When it snows in the mountains, the skiing is world-class. But when high pressure settles in, Denver gets trapped under a brown cloud while the mountains sparkle above. Bring layers either way.
